2012-12-10 39 views
1

我只是使用代碼將場景從一個場景推送到另一個場景。無法初始化CCScene類型的參數COCOS2D

這是我的代碼。

SettingScene *setting=[SettingScene node]; 
[[CCDirector sharedDirector]pushScene:setting]; 

我已經使用上述另一種方法相同的是工作正常,但在這條線就顯示錯誤...

/Users/jellyfishtechnologies/Desktop/Vivek/My Game Project/Flyer/Flyer/HomePageScene.mm:91:43: Cannot initialize a parameter of type 'CCScene *' with an lvalue of type 'SettingScene *' 

我不明白什麼確切的問題!

+0

顯示'SettingScene'的定義。 – trojanfoe

+0

你是否在SettingScene類中實現了場景方法? –

+2

確保您的SettingScene是CCScene的子類。 – Morion

回答

3

也許你的SETTINGS類不是CCScene的子類,或者它沒有返回CCScene對象。請驗證這一點。

相關問題